Transaction 65e74904730a4a7956a943e9d81436e5d05881dcd57e914d958f2762a4d5f0ea
1 Input
1 Output
-
65e74904730a4a7956a943e9d81436e5d05881dcd57e914d958f2762a4d5f0ea:0
- value
- 12956754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1629f4a82ee9a00cb61dd9c3436174c17712dcf OP_EQUAL
- address
- 3PhLvAg5NEE6qCP8hEucs2cHYPqpYexa76